Outlaw Radial Championships-Saturday

It's Saturday morning here at Bradenton for the Outlaw Radial Tire Championships and we are still haveing some very light rain on and off but the crew is drying things up and prepping the track for racing.















The racers are getting ready, warming the cars up and making preparation for todays racing.



There is a front moving through, though it's taking it's time doing so the one thing I can say is that when the weather clears we are going to have some great racing.

Word is the Scranton entry is likely to get the big DQ this morning. I'll have some info about all this from Matt and Jay coming soon.

The cars are getting the call to the lanes right now, Be back later...

Round One Update

Round One Drag Radial



Will Stevenson was one of the first pair down in radial with a 4.83.



Team North member Ritchie Stine ran 5.03 @ 143.



Kevin Fiscus runs a 4.99 for his first hit of the day.



David Wolfe takes number one spot with a 4.79 @ 159.



David Hance got loose and did a nice job on the save.



Dave Hinzman shook the tires and had to pedal to a 5.19



Tony Ridenour was lined up againt Stretch from South Florida and got loose just touching the
wall at the top end after doing an awesomejob of avoiding the car in the other lane.



Mel Nelson showed a 4.50 on the boards but he left before the tree was activated and there was some
sort of malfunction and the run was disallowed.

There are 77 cars that made it for first round.

Top ten after round one are..


1.David Wolfe - 4.79
2.Will Stevenson - 4.83
3.Shane Stack - 4.92
4.Scott Bitzer - 4.94
5.Kevin Fiscus - 4.99
6.Steve Jackson - 5.07
7.Ritchie Stine - 5.07
8.Jason Richards - 5.07
9.Al Marlow - 5.11
10.Brian Criste - 5.16

Round one Outlaw 10.5

10.5 has 33 cars for first round.



Mike Stavrinos holds the number one spot in the Speed and Truck World Corvette.



Bryan Markiewicz site at number two.



Jake Carlton hold the third spot for a 1,2,3 for Nelson Competition Inc. horsepower.



Tim Lynch had to lift on his first round pass.

First round top ten in 10.5...

1.Mike Stavrinos - 4.45
2.Bryan Markiewicz - 4.530
3.Jake Carlton - 4.537
4.Conrad Scarry - 4.54
5.Richard Sexton - 4.55
6.Tony Johnson - 4.60
7.Jim Blair - 4.63
8.Dale Collins Jr. - 4.76
9."Wild Man" Jimmy Hall - 4.80
10.Scott Gaudagno - 4.81

In the boost vs no boost race it is David Wolfe and Will Stevenson for the boosted side, and Scott Bitzer and Haward Spires for the nitrous boys.



Will Stevenson



David Wolfe

First round saw David Wolfe take the holeshot win over Stevenson, 7.34 to Will's 7.33. Will's time at the 1/8 was 4.77



Scott Bitzer



Howard Spires

Both the nitrous cars had problems with Spires loosing traction and Bitzer popping and banging down the track.

The final is set for Wolfe vs Bitzer, waiting for them to come to the lanes now.

As I reported earlier there were some great saves and crashes today. One involved Dave Hance from New York Motorsports.















Tony Ridenour got loose and did an outstanding job of avoiding the car in the other lane. He did eventually graze the wall at the top end, though not enough to be concered about for racing.
Murphys law strikes again as the car was just repainted. He came back to run a 4.76 @ 162 to take the number one qualifying spot.





In Outlaw 10.5 Mike Stavrinos is looking strong with a 4.407 in round three qualifying, however he was nudged aside by .001 by Richard Sexton from the Mobley camp in the Fulton Powered GTO.

Saturday Night Happenings







Troy Pirez Jr. and the Ali Belford crew pulled an all nighter repairing a bad cylinder. They tore it down to replace a piston and got a replacement valve from Matt at H.P.S. Cylinder Heads in Tarpon Springs.





Ed Feaster had some bad luck breaking several rocker arms pulling out of the trailer Friday. He was hoping to make a hit but since all three rounds of qualifying was finished Saturday that wasn’t to be. He is installing the replacement set that was shipped to the track, to bad you can’t fax this stuff.



See that smoke under the chair ?? Believe it or not those are firecrackers going off and this guy is STILL sleeping. I though for sure I’d get a funny picture with him jumping out of his skin but after three tries we gave up.



Terrance Whalen shredded a ring gear during Qualifying Saturday and they made the repairs to get ready for Sunday eliminations.
